Ingredients
Delicious, creamy homemade milkshakes in a variety of flavors!
For the Milkshake
- 1½ cups ice cream (about 4 large scoops, vanilla or chocolate)
- ¼ cup milk (full fat)
For Garnish
- Whipped topping (for garnish)
- Sprinkles (for garnish)
- Maraschino cherries or strawberries (for garnish)
- ¼ cup chocolate syrup (with chocolate ice cream)
- 4 strawberries (sliced)

How to Make Milkshake Recipe
Step 1: Blend the Ingredients
In a blender, combine the ice cream and milk. If you’re making chocolate or strawberry versions, add any optional flavorings at this time. Blend until smooth.
Step 2: Serve in a Tall Glass
Pour the blended mixture into a tall glass.
Step 3: Add Garnishes
Top your milkshake with whipped topping, sprinkles, and a maraschino cherry if desired. Enjoy your delicious homemade treat!

How to Perfect Milkshake Recipe
To achieve the perfect milkshake, consider these helpful tips. Each step can enhance the flavor and texture of your drink.
- Bold Ice Cream Selection: Choose high-quality ice cream for richer flavors.
- Cold Ingredients: Ensure that your ingredients are chilled before blending for a thicker shake.
- Blend at High Speed: Blend thoroughly at high speed to achieve a smooth consistency without lumps.
- Adjust Thickness: Add more milk if you prefer a thinner shake, or more ice cream for thickness.
- Flavor Variations: Experiment with different syrups or fruits to create unique flavors.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making a milkshake at home can be easy, but there are some common mistakes to watch out for. Here are a few tips to ensure your milkshake recipe turns out perfect every time.
- Using too much milk: Adding too much milk can make your milkshake runny. Start with the recommended amount and add more only if needed.
- Not blending long enough: Failing to blend long enough can leave chunks in your milkshake. Blend until smooth for the best texture.
- Forgetting the garnishes: Garnishes elevate your milkshake’s appearance and flavor. Don’t skip the whipped topping, sprinkles, or cherries!
- Choosing low-quality ice cream: The quality of ice cream affects the taste of your milkshake. Use good quality ice cream for a richer flavor.
- Ignoring temperature: If your ingredients are too warm, it can affect the consistency. Make sure your ice cream is frozen solid before blending.

Frequently Asked Questions
How can I customize my Milkshake Recipe?
You can customize this milkshake recipe by adding fruits, cookies, or flavored syrups. Get creative with your favorite ingredients!
What is the best ice cream for making a Milkshake?
For a delicious milkshake, use high-quality vanilla or chocolate ice cream. This will give you a rich and creamy texture.
Can I make a dairy-free Milkshake Recipe?
Yes! Substitute regular ice cream with dairy-free options like almond or coconut-based ice creams for a tasty dairy-free treat.
How do I make my Milkshake thicker?
To achieve a thicker consistency, add less milk or use frozen ingredients like ice cubes or extra scoops of ice cream.

📖 Recipe Card
Print
Homemade Milkshake
- Total Time: 5 minutes
- Yield: Serves 2
Description
Indulge in the ultimate homemade milkshake experience with this quick and easy recipe that transforms simple ingredients into a creamy delight. Perfect for any occasion, from summer parties to cozy nights in, these milkshakes are sure to impress family and friends alike. With endless flavor combinations and the option to customize with your favorite toppings, you can whip up a personalized treat in just minutes.
Ingredients
- 1½ cups ice cream (vanilla or chocolate)
- ¼ cup full-fat milk
- Whipped topping (for garnish)
- Sprinkles (for garnish)
- Maraschino cherries or sliced strawberries (for garnish)
- Optional: ¼ cup chocolate syrup (for chocolate shakes)
Instructions
- In a blender, combine the ice cream and milk. If desired, add flavorings like chocolate syrup or fruit at this stage.
- Blend until smooth and creamy.
- Pour the mixture into a tall glass.
- Top with whipped cream, sprinkles, and your choice of fruit garnishes before serving.
- Prep Time: 5 minutes
- Cook Time: 0 minutes
- Category: Dessert
- Method: Blending
- Cuisine: American
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 milkshake (approximately 12 oz)
- Calories: 400
- Sugar: 40g
- Sodium: 120mg
- Fat: 18g
- Saturated Fat: 10g
- Unsaturated Fat: 6g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 54g
- Fiber: 0g
- Protein: 7g
- Cholesterol: 70mg
